Description
These tracks under the Pacific Coast Highway overpass at Washington Street lead off the main rail spur into Marine Corps Recruit Depot. They cut across the PCH exit ramps north and southbound, and across the foot of Washington Street. They are angled across the streets at an angle to direction of traffic flow are filled in with dirt and asphalt in some places, but are very dangerous to motorcyclists and cyclists in particular. This picture makes it clear that cyclists in particular have to swing out into traffic to steer around deep potholes. THERE IS NO REASON FOR THIS SPUR TO EVEN BE HERE ANYMORE.
